    It has been on-topic before, but it doesn´t hurt to remind that there´s an alternative to windows where the goal is to "...achieve complete binary compatibility with both applications and device drivers meant for NT and XP operating systems, by using a similar architecture and providing a complete and equivalent public interface" (source: http://www.reactos.org/en/index.html). In other words: it isn´t a clone to windows, but rather a windows replacement that behaves just like windows, running win32 software. It´s still in alpha stage (ver. 0.3.3) but it seems there will be a beta release next year.
